  • Title

    Experimental validation of a miniature implantable RFID tag antenna for small animals monitoring

  • Abstract
    This paper addresses the design and measurement of an implantable RFID tag for small animal monitoring applications. In particular, the design of a miniature printed dipole antenna and its integration with a commercial RFID transceiver is discussed. Some preliminary numerical results of the antenna performance when implanted under the mouse skin are presented. The experimental validation of the designed antenna in a realistic scenario will be successively provided.
